#e89518 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e89518 is composed of 91% red, 58.4%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.8% magenta, 89.7%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 36.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 50.2%. #e89518 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ff30 with #d12b00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

● #e89518 color description : Vivid orange.
#e89518 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e89518 has RGB values of R:232, G:149,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.9,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15242520.
